So many of you responded to my query on this cemetery and some of you indicated you had ancestors buried there too -- I thought you might be interested in the following history received from Thomas Hill, [email protected] ************** I attach the summary for this meeting in my list of all properties for Hicksite meetings in southwest Ohio, Indiana and Kentucky (20th Century). We attempted to deed the property described as "Location 2" to the Paint Township Trustees four years ago, but I do not know if they ever recorded the deed. The meeting records, including burials, are kept in the OVYM archives at the Wilmington College Quaker Collection. Tom Hill one of the Ohio Valley Yearly Meeting Trustees PROPERTY OF MEETINGS IN OHIO VALLEY YEARLY MEETING 24. MEETING: Fall Creek Monthly SUPERIOR MEETINGS: Clear Creek P.M. 1807/09/07-1809/08/12 Miami M.M. until 1807/09/07 Fairfield M.M. 1807/09/07-1811/05/11 Redstone Q.M. until 1809/03/06 Miami Q.M. 1809/05/13-1814/11/12 Fairfield Q.M. 1815/02/04-1829/07/18 Center P.M. after 1854/11/11 Miami Q.M. after 1829/08/08 ESTABLISHED: Indulged 1806/09/11 Worship 1807/09/07 Preparative 1809/08/12 Monthly 1811/05/11 LAID DOWN: Preparative 1852/11/13 (monthly renamed Clear Creek M.M. that date) Worship 1865 LOCATION 1: Just South of 7965 Worley Mill Rd. Auditor's No. 32-12-000-355.02 Paint Twp., Survey 2521 Highland Cty., Ohio DEEDS, ETC.: 1. Bowater & Rebecca Sumner to Walter Canady, Gorman Ballard & John VanPelt, Trustees appointed by the Society of Friends for fall creek particular Monthly Meeting; 1819/06/17; D.B. O, pp. 457-459; T.D.B. 6, pp. 96-97. 2. Robert Sumner, Jonathan B. Cowgill & Richard C. Barnett, Trustees of Fall Creek particular meeting of (Orthodox) Friends, to Thomas Clemens; 1877/03/03; D.B. 52, p. 217. 3. Robert Sumner, Jonathan B. Cowgill & R. C. Barrett, Trustees of Fall Creek particular meeting of (Orthodox) Friends, to Amos Williams; 1878/01/10; D.B. 53, pp. 23-24. 4. [FBG] Highland Monthly Meeting (by Trustees Robert A. Hussey & Douglas B. Woodmansee) and Miami Monthly Meeting of Friends (by Trustees Milton E. Cook, Richard B. Furnas, Seth E. Furnas, Jr., Mary H. Hartsock & Stephen W. Nichols) [quit claim] to Trustees of Fall Creek Monthly Meeting; 1995/09/18 et seq.; O.R. 144, pp. 334-338. 5. Grant of Tax Exemption to Fall Creek Monthly Meeting; Highland Cty. No. 308; 1997/04/30; DTE No. AE 3119 LOCATION 2: School & FBG Overman Road, C.R. 83 North of Ross Lane/Karnes Road Auditor's Map 32-11-000-206.00 Stringtown, Hillsboro P.O. 45133 Paint Twp., Fields Survey 4714/5828 Highland Cty., Ohio DEEDS, ETC.: 5. Wm., Samuel & John W. Pope & Thomas W. Sanders, heirs of Nathaniel Pope, decd., to Elias Overman & Wm. Newby, Trustees appointed by Fall Creek Meeting; 1830/09/29; T.D.B. 10, p. 544. 6. Elias Overman & Wm. Newby, Trustees of the Society of Friends of Fall Creek, to William Wolf; 1836/12/18; D.B. 4, p. 530. 7. William & Margaret Wolfe to Elias Overman & John George, Trustees of the Society of Friends of Fall Creek Meeting; 1838/05/12; D.B. 6, pp. 153-154. 8. Graveyard Trustees of Miami Monthly Meeting of Friends (Milton E. Cook, Mary H. Hartsock, Richard B. Furnas, Seth E. Furnas & Stephen W. Nichols) to Trustees of Paint Township; 1995/08/09 & 1995/08/15; O.R.
